Jellel Gasteli (born in Tunis in 1958) is a French-Tunisian photographer. He is best known for his minimalistic "White Series" (La Série Blanche), which captures the geometry of light and shadow on traditional white-washed Tunisian buildings.[1] Having lived many years in Paris, Gasteli is currently residing in Tunis.[2]

Gasteli's work was included in the exhibition Africa Remix at the Mori Art Museum.[3]
